Installing and Removing an External USB Disk Drive, eSATA Drive, SATA Port Multiplier
Categories: Hard Drives/Storage
| NOTE: | There are two parts to adding external drives: connect the drive to a USB port and then initialize the drive so it becomes part of the total server storage. |
- Plug in the USB cable into one of the USB ports on the server.
- To plug in and power up your external USB drive, see the documentation that came with your USB disk drive.
CAUTION: The addition of multiple USB disk drives through an external USB hub is neither recommended nor supported. Figure 1: Connecting a USB disk drive to HP MediaSmart Server
- Plug in the Serial ATA cable into the eSATA port on the back of the server, as shown in the following figure.
- To plug in and power up your eSATA disk drive or SATA port multiplier, see the documentation that came with your device.Figure 2: Location of eSATA connector
